Keto Breakfast Sandwiches with Sausage
Flaky and cheesy biscuits are filled with juicy sausage making these the perfect easy keto breakfast.

Servings: 8 servings
Calories: 478kcal
- 1 cup cheddar cheese shredded
- 3 ounces cream cheese softened
- 2 eggs
- 2 cups almond flour extra fine
- 1 tsp baking powder
- 1/4 tsp salt
- 1/4 cup heavy whipping cream
- 1 tbsp butter melted
- 1 pound breakfast sausage rounds, or bulk
Preheat oven to 350-F.
In a large mixing bowl combine the cream cheese, eggs and cheddar cheese. Stir until cream cheese is smooth.
Add to the cream cheese mixture, almond flour, baking powder, salt, heavy cream and the melted butter. Stir until just combined - don't overmix or they'll be hard.
Chill the dough in the fridge for about 30 minutes to make handling easier.
Sprinkle almond flour on a hard surface. Pat the biscuit dough to about 1/2 inch thick and use a circle cookie cutter or a mason jar to cut the biscuits into 8 rounds.
Put the biscuits on a parchment-paper lined sheet pan and bake for about 15 minutes at 350-F.
Meanwhile, cook the sausage patties as per instructions on the package.
To assemble, cut cooled biscuits in half and pop a sausage patty inside. Enjoy!
Serving: 1sandwich | Calories: 478kcal | Carbohydrates: 7g | Protein: 20g | Fat: 42g | Saturated Fat: 14g | Cholesterol: 122mg | Sodium: 639mg | Potassium: 190mg | Fiber: 3g | Sugar: 1g | Vitamin A: 539IU | Vitamin C: 1mg | Calcium: 217mg | Iron: 2mg | Net Carbohydrates: 4g
